How they compare

Moldova currently reports 20.3% against 6.4% in GPE: Europe & Central Asia Wb Fy24, December 2024, a difference of 13.9%.

That makes Moldova's figure about 3.2 times GPE: Europe & Central Asia Wb Fy24, December 2024's.

Across all 25 years both countries report, Moldova has been ahead every year.

GPE: Europe & Central Asia Wb Fy24, December 2024 ranks 6th and Moldova ranks 3rd of 218 groups.

Moldova has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ade GPE: Europe & Central Asia Wb Fy24, December 2024 Moldova Difference Ahead
1990s 1.0% 8.1% 7.1% Moldova
2000s 0.9% 6.5% 5.6% Moldova
2010s 3.2% 13.2% 9.9% Moldova
2020s 5.9% 21.1% 15.2% Moldova

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
